More about beach lifeguard courses in Northern Territory
If you are looking to embark on a rewarding career as a beach lifeguard, you can find a variety of Beach Lifeguard courses in Northern Territory tailored to equip you with essential skills and training. With a total of three courses available, beginners with no prior experience will benefit greatly from these comprehensive programs. Courses such as Provide Basic Emergency Life Support HLTAID010, Provide Emergency Care for Suspected Spinal Injury PUAEME007, and Participate in a Rescue Operation PUASAR022 offer valuable insights into emergencies that can occur at the beach.
Training providers such as St John Ambulance Australia and SDS deliver these Beach Lifeguard courses in Northern Territory. They are recognised as Registered Training Organisations (RTOs) and are committed to providing high-quality training to future lifeguards.
